#
# Makefile.mingw
#
# Description: Makefile for win32 (mingw) version of libpurple
#

PIDGIN_TREE_TOP := ..
include $(PIDGIN_TREE_TOP)/libpurple/win32/global.mak

TARGET = libpurple
NEEDED_DLLS = $(LIBXML2_TOP)/bin/libxml2-2.dll

##
## INCLUDE PATHS
##
INCLUDE_PATHS +=	\
			-I$(PURPLE_TOP) \
			-I$(PURPLE_TOP)/win32 \
			-I$(PIDGIN_TREE_TOP) \
			-I$(GTK_TOP)/include \
			-I$(GTK_TOP)/include/glib-2.0 \
			-I$(GTK_TOP)/lib/glib-2.0/include \
			-I$(LIBXML2_TOP)/include/libxml2

LIB_PATHS +=		-L$(GTK_TOP)/lib \
			-L$(LIBXML2_TOP)/lib

##
##  SOURCES, OBJECTS
##
C_SRC =	\
			account.c \
			accountopt.c \
			blist.c \
			buddyicon.c \
			certificate.c \
			cipher.c \
			ciphers/des.c \
			ciphers/gchecksum.c \
			ciphers/hmac.c \
			ciphers/md4.c \
			ciphers/md5.c \
			ciphers/rc4.c \
			ciphers/sha1.c \
			ciphers/sha256.c \
			circbuffer.c \
			cmds.c \
			connection.c \
			conversation.c \
			core.c \
			debug.c \
			dnsquery.c \
			dnssrv.c \
			eventloop.c \
			ft.c \
			idle.c \
			imgstore.c \
			log.c \
			mediamanager.c \
			media.c \
			mime.c \
			nat-pmp.c \
			network.c \
			notify.c \
			ntlm.c \
			plugin.c \
			pluginpref.c \
			pounce.c \
			prefs.c \
			privacy.c \
			proxy.c \
			prpl.c \
			request.c \
			roomlist.c \
			savedstatuses.c \
			server.c \
			signals.c \
			smiley.c \
			sound-theme-loader.c \
			sound-theme.c \
			sound.c \
			sslconn.c \
			status.c \
			stringref.c \
			stun.c \
			theme-loader.c \
			theme-manager.c \
			theme.c \
			upnp.c \
			util.c \
			value.c \
			version.c \
			whiteboard.c \
			xmlnode.c \
			win32/giowin32.c \
			win32/libc_interface.c \
			win32/win32dep.c

RC_SRC = win32/libpurplerc.rc

OBJECTS = $(C_SRC:%.c=%.o) $(RC_SRC:%.rc=%.o)

##
## LIBRARIES
##
LIBS =	\
		-lglib-2.0 \
		-lgthread-2.0 \
		-lgobject-2.0 \
		-lgmodule-2.0 \
		-lintl \
		-lws2_32 \
		-lxml2

include $(PIDGIN_COMMON_RULES)

##
## TARGET DEFINITIONS
##
.PHONY: all install install_shallow clean

all: $(TARGET).dll
	$(MAKE) -C $(PURPLE_PROTOS_TOP) -f $(MINGW_MAKEFILE)
	$(MAKE) -C $(PURPLE_PLUGINS_TOP) -f $(MINGW_MAKEFILE)

install_shallow: $(PURPLE_INSTALL_DIR) $(TARGET).dll
	cp $(TARGET).dll $(PURPLE_INSTALL_DIR)
	cp $(NEEDED_DLLS) $(PURPLE_INSTALL_DIR)

install: install_shallow all
	$(MAKE) -C $(PURPLE_PROTOS_TOP) -f $(MINGW_MAKEFILE) install
	$(MAKE) -C $(PURPLE_PLUGINS_TOP) -f $(MINGW_MAKEFILE) install

./win32/libpurplerc.rc: ./win32/libpurplerc.rc.in $(PIDGIN_TREE_TOP)/VERSION
	sed -e 's/@PURPLE_VERSION@/$(PURPLE_VERSION)/g' \
	    $@.in > $@

$(OBJECTS): $(PURPLE_CONFIG_H) $(PURPLE_VERSION_H) $(PURPLE_PURPLE_H)

$(TARGET).dll $(TARGET).dll.a: $(OBJECTS)
	$(CC) -shared $(OBJECTS) $(LIB_PATHS) $(LIBS) $(DLL_LD_FLAGS) -Wl,--output-def,$(TARGET).def,--out-implib,$(TARGET).dll.a -o $(TARGET).dll

##
## CLEAN RULES
##
clean:
	rm -f $(OBJECTS) $(RC_SRC) $(PURPLE_VERSION_H) $(PURPLE_PURPLE_H)
	rm -f $(TARGET).dll $(TARGET).dll.a $(TARGET).def
	$(MAKE) -C $(PURPLE_PROTOS_TOP) -f $(MINGW_MAKEFILE) clean
	$(MAKE) -C $(PURPLE_PLUGINS_TOP) -f $(MINGW_MAKEFILE) clean

include $(PIDGIN_COMMON_TARGETS)
